Arman Tsarukyan is one of the very best lightweights in the world not yet to hold a title. He announced himself in his 2019 UFC debut by pushing Islam Makhachev to a razor-thin decision, then built one of the deepest resumes in the division on the back of elite, smothering wrestling.
Unlike many grapplers, Tsarukyan fights with an aggressive, attacking mindset and steadily improving striking, chaining takedowns while pressing forward. He's beaten a murderer's row of contenders - Charles Oliveira, Beneil Dariush, Dan Hooker - to firmly establish himself as a number-one contender at 155 pounds.
